So, what exactly *is* a Grafana repeat panel variable? Simply put, it's a powerful feature that allows you to automatically generate multiple panels based on the values selected in a dashboard variable. Think of it like this: instead of manually creating dozens of panels for different servers, regions, or applications, you can use a single variable to dynamically create and display a panel for each selected item. This means less manual work for you and a more agile, customized experience for your users. The repeat panel feature can be linked to a dashboard variable. When a variable's selection changes, Grafana automatically generates new panels or removes existing ones to match the current selection. This is incredibly useful for comparing metrics across different entities (like servers), visualizing data for each instance of a particular service, or allowing users to focus on a subset of data without cluttering the dashboard.
